在学习利用velocity生成模板时,出现错误如下:
org.apache.velocity.exception.ParseErrorException: Encountered " } </td>\r\n <td>" at template/list.jsp[line 57, column 17]
Was expecting one of:
"}" ...
<DOT> ...
原因是jsp页面中<td>${xxx }中大括号里有空格,将空格删去,${xxxxx},则测试代码通过
如果有大神知道原理,希望能冒个泡,告知原因。
本文解决了一个在使用Velocity生成模板时遇到的问题,即ParseErrorException。错误出现在特定的jsp文件中,原因是${符号后的空格导致。删除空格后,测试代码通过。

被折叠的 条评论
为什么被折叠?



